Date: February 8, 2000
SUBJECT: Valley Transportation Plan 2020 Bicycle Element Project List
EXECUTIVE SUMMARY
The Santa Clara Valley Transportation Authority (VTA) is updating the long range transportation plan for Santa Clara County. The updated countywide transportation plan, named the Valley Transportation Plan 2020 (VTP 2020), will guide planning and programming decisions for most outside transportation funding (i.e. State and Federal funds) for the next 20 years. Projects that do not appear in a countywide transportation plan are ineligible for State and Federal funding. The VTP 2020 will be considered for adoption by the VTA Board of Directors in Spring, 2000.
The City Council considered a list of roadway projects for inclusion in the VTP 2020 at its May 11, 1999 meeting. At this time, the VTA is focusing on the Bicycle Element of the countywide transportation plan. The VTA has requested that local jurisdictions submit lists of bicycle project needs. These lists will be incorporated in the Bicycle Element of VTP 2020, and a ten year expenditure plan will be formulated. This expenditure plan will program Transportation Development Act (TDA) funding, Transportation Fund for Clean Air (TFCA) Program Manager funds, 1996 Measure A/B Bicycle funds, and Transportation Equity Act for the 21st Century (TEA-21) Enhancement funds. Staff has assembled a list of currently unfunded projects based on the Land Use and Transportation Element of the General Plan, the Bicycle Opportunities Study findings and BAC input. This list is included as Attachment 1. Because considerable refinement of the Bicycle Opportunities Study recommendations will occur over the next decades, this list should not be considered final and absolute. The Bicycle Opportunities Study identifies most probable or feasible alternatives, not absolute projects. Detailed design engineering, public outreach, and project prioritization will likely result in changes to the City’s bikeway plans. However, at this time, so as not to preclude funding for further planning and construction of a comprehensive bikeway network in Sunnyvale, staff recommends submitting the enclosed project proposals.

Fiscal Impact
Adoption of this project list does not cause a direct fiscal impact to the City. At this time the VTA is requesting that cities commit to providing a 20% local match for any project that is programmed for funding by the VTA and approved for construction by the City. Staff is not recommending budgeting any funds for any projects at this time however. Budgeting decisions would occur on a project-specific basis at the time funding was approved and programmed by the VTA.
Failure to adopt a bicycle project list and have projects included in the Valley Transportation Plan 2020 would potentially preclude projects from receiving consideration for outside funding.
